Rongtu - Bajengdoba, North Garo Hills

Rongtu is a village situated in the Bajengdoba subdivision of North Garo Hills district, Meghalaya. It is located approximately 25 km from Resubelpara and around 102 km from Williamnagar.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Rongtu is 274517. The village falls under the 794004 pincode.

Rongtu village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system. For political representation, the village falls under the Bajengdoba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Tura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Rongtu

As per Census 2011, Rongtu village has a total population of 76 people, consisting of 37 males and 39 females. The village has 15 households and a sex ratio of 1,054 females per 1,000 males. There are 10 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 50 literate and 26 illiterate residents. Additionally, 75 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Rongtu

Rongtu is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Williamnagar to Rongtu is about 102 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.9 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
